 SEA KAYAKING STAGE ONE SKILLS COURSE

A comprehensive course designed to cover the skills required to become a technically correct and safe paddler. The course is arranged in a progressive manner to allow you to develop the techniques and your confidence at an enjoyable pace with great end results.
 
PROGRAMME
*Note Pool session time may change
 
FRIDAY EVENING 7.00PM TO 8.30PM: WET EXITS, WATER CONFIDENCE & RESCUES
Fletcher Challenge Energy Aquatic Centre indoor heated pool. (Kawaroa Park)
Here we will teach you about the easy ways of entering and exiting a kayak along with the methods of self and group rescues - all in the warm waters of our pool.
 
SATURDAY 9.00AM TO 4.00PM: PADDLE & BOAT HANDLING SKILLS AND RESCUES
Meet at Canoe & Kayak Taranaki shop (6/631 Devon Rd, Waiwakaiho, New Plymouth)
Paddle skills and rescue techniques are the main way of preventing potential problems and guaranteeing enjoyment so the day is spent giving you the skills and practise time to allow you to develop them.
 
SUNDAY 8.30AM TO 4.00PM: PLANNING, PACKING AND GROUP CONTROL                    
Meet at Canoe & Kayak Taranaki shop (6/631 Devon Rd, Waiwakaiho, New Plymouth)
We head off for the day to cover the issues of paddling in the Taranaki area, including weather, basic navigation, trip planning, communications, group management, safety equipment and procedures whilst having an enjoyable days outing. The day is spent leisurely exploring an area of the Taranaki waterways.
 
 
INFORMATION
BRING: Warm changes of clothes / raincoat / Polypropylene or woollen tops and bottoms / Wet suit / Windproof and waterproof jacket.
Hats for sun and cold / Sunscreen / sun glasses (a cord is recommended to prevent loss) / wet weather foot wear -old sandshoes or dive booties.

 

1st YEAR CLUB MEMBERSHIP, SATURDAY LUNCH AND KAYAK HIRE ARE INCLUDED IN FEES.
